Question closing off unused rooms from cool/heat

I am wanting to "close off" unused rooms in my house to help lower cooling and heating costs. I just am unsure if this is that effective. Do I just close off the vents blowing out cool/hot air, or should I close/cover the cold air return too? It is a four bedroom house, where only two bedrooms are used.
